Danske Bank A S bought a new position in Ameriprise Financial, Inc. (NYSE:AMP – Free Report) in the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the SEC. The fund bought 107,465 shares of the financial services provider’s stock, valued at approximately $49,301,000.

Ameriprise Financial Price Performance
AMP opened at $562.89 on Wednesday. The company has a market capitalization of $50.60 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 13.58, a PEG ratio of 0.77 and a beta of 1.14. The company has a current ratio of 0.71, a quick ratio of 0.71 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.99. Ameriprise Financial, Inc. has a 12-month low of $422.37 and a 12-month high of $572.56. The business’s fifty day simple moving average is $511.57 and its 200-day simple moving average is $481.04.
Ameriprise Financial (NYSE:AMP –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July 23rd. The financial services provider reported $11.07 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$10.81 by $0.26. Ameriprise Financial had a net margin of 20.24% and a return on equity of 64.19%. The company had revenue of $4.90 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.87 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$9.11 earnings per share.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 11.6%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, equities research analysts anticipate that Ameriprise Financial, Inc. will post 46.12 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
Ameriprise Financial Dividend Announcement
The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, August 21st. Stockholders of record on Monday, August 3rd will be paid a dividend of $1.70 per share. The ex-dividend date is Monday, August 3rd. This represents a $6.80 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.2%. Ameriprise Financial’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 16.40%.
About Ameriprise Financial
Ameriprise Financial, Inc is a diversified financial services company headquartered in Minneapolis, Minnesota. The firm provides a range of advice-based wealth management, asset management and insurance products to individual and institutional clients. Its business model centers on delivering financial planning and investment advice through a network of financial advisors alongside proprietary product offerings designed to meet retirement, protection and accumulation needs.
Core products and services include comprehensive financial planning and advisory services, managed investment portfolios, retirement planning solutions, annuities and life insurance products.
